Preparing the Site: Key Steps
Thorough site preparation is essential for a successful concrete installation process. To begin, the area must be cleared of debris, vegetation, and any existing structures. This step guarantees a clean, stable foundation. Following this, the soil is evaluated more information for compaction and drainage capabilities; if necessary, it may be compacted or treated to improve stability. Next, proper grading is performed to establish a level surface and facilitate water runoff. Installing forms is also crucial, as they define the shape and dimensions of the concrete pour. Subsequently, reinforcing materials, such as rebar or wire mesh, are positioned to enhance the concrete's strength. Proper execution of these steps lays the groundwork for a durable and reliable concrete structure.
Understanding Curing Process Importance
Though commonly neglected, the curing process fulfills a critical purpose in the success of a concrete installation. This phase initiates promptly once the concrete is poured and necessitates sustaining adequate moisture, temperature, and time to let the concrete obtain its intended strength and durability. Proper curing stops complications including cracking, surface scaling, and weaknesses in the material. Techniques may include placing over the surface wet burlap, using curing compounds, or applying plastic sheeting to retain moisture. Typically, the curing period extends from a few days to several weeks, based on environmental conditions and the specific concrete mix used. Understanding the significance of this process ensures that the final structure remains dependable and durable, meeting the expectations of clients.

Regular Cleaning Practices
Regular maintenance routines are necessary for maintaining the lifespan and look of concrete surfaces. Routine maintenance, like sweeping away debris and dirt, helps prevent staining and deterioration. High-pressure cleaning can remove stubborn marks, algae, or moss that may accumulate over time. It is wise to use a soft cleanser during this process to minimize chemical damage. Furthermore, promptly treating spills, particularly from oil or chemicals, can avoid permanent discoloration. In cold weather regions, clearing snow and ice is crucial to avoid cracking due to ice expansion. Regular inspections for cracks or surface wear can also aid in identifying issues early, making certain that concrete surfaces remain sturdy and aesthetically pleasing for years to come.
Sealant Application Frequency
Usually, putting on a sealant to concrete surfaces every one through three years is crucial for upholding their structural integrity and visual appeal. This interval varies with factors such as weather conditions, foot traffic, and the type of sealant used. Consistent inspections can aid in establishing when reapplication is essential; indicators like discoloration, wear, or water penetration demonstrate that the sealant has deteriorated. Homeowners should choose superior sealants designed for their specific concrete applications, guaranteeing better durability. Furthermore, proper surface preparation before application improves adhesion and effectiveness. By sticking to this maintenance schedule, property owners can safeguard their concrete investments, extending the lifespan of surfaces and reducing costly repairs in the future.
Innovation and Emerging Developments in Contemporary Concrete Systems
How is the concrete field transforming to satisfy the requirements of a fast-paced changing environment? Advancements in concrete technology are forming a more environmentally responsible and resilient future. Researchers are developing eco-friendly alternatives, such as recycled aggregates and bio-based additives, which minimize the carbon footprint of concrete production. Furthermore, advancements in smart concrete—incorporating sensors that monitor structural health—facilitate proactive maintenance, enhancing safety and durability.
Yet another emerging trend is the application of 3D printing innovation, allowing for fast construction of intricate structures with limited waste. Furthermore, self-healing concrete, which utilizes bacteria or alternative materials to repair cracks automatically, is attracting momentum, delivering extended-life infrastructure systems.
As urban expansion continues and climate change influences building practices, these advancements showcase the industry's dedication to sustainability and efficiency. The future of concrete technology contains vast possibilities for transforming how society builds, providing structures that are both durable and environmentally responsible.

How Much Time Does Concrete Usually Need to Cure Fully?
Concrete normally takes roughly 28 days to achieve complete curing, even though initial setting occurs within hours. Elements including temperature, humidity, and mix design can impact the curing process and overall strength development.
What Are the Available Concrete Finish Types?
Numerous concrete finishes encompass polished, stamped, exposed aggregate, brushed, and troweled. Each individual finish presents distinctive aesthetics and textures, meeting distinct design preferences and functional requirements in commercial and residential applications.
Is It Possible to Pour Concrete in Cold Weather?
Certainly, concrete can be placed in cold weather, but specific precautions are essential. Appropriate techniques and materials, such as heated water and insulating blankets, help make certain the concrete cures effectively despite lower temperatures.
What Steps Should I Take if My Concrete Develops Cracks?
When cracks form in concrete, evaluate the severity of the damage. Small cracks can be filled with a concrete patching compound, while larger cracks may need professional evaluation and repair to ensure structural integrity and prevent more deterioration.
How Do I Know if My Concrete Requires Resurfacing?
To evaluate whether concrete requires resurfacing, homeowners should look for apparent cracks, uneven surfaces, or discoloration. In addition, accumulated water or a rough texture might suggest that resurfacing is essential for enhanced aesthetics and functionality.
